Gaming Corps makes key European addition with Fortuna Entertainment Group partnership

Fortuna to offer Gaming Corps’ premium content across all five of its Central/Eastern European markets
Gaming Corps – a publicly-listed game development company based in Sweden — has made a high-profile addition to its growing list of partners across Central and Eastern Europe after reaching an agreement with Fortuna Entertainment Group.
Founded in 1990, Fortuna is an omni-channel company and prides itself as the largest betting and gaming operator in Central and Eastern Europe. Fortuna has grown to more than 6,000 employees and operates across five markets: Czechia, Slovakia, Poland, Romania and Croatia.
The company’s iGaming arm will now store Gaming Corps’ full premium games suite within its portfolio, including Crash, Mine, Table and Slot titles, along with a certified Plinko. Fortuna’s players can make the most of some of Gaming Corps’ most successful games series, such as Jet Lucky and Coin Miner. They can also enjoy some smash hits released by Gaming Corps this year, with Wild Woof, Raging Zeus Mines, Shootout Champion and Ramen Puzzle among them.
